Key differences between Scala and CoffeeScript
Characteristic | Scala | CoffeeScript |
---|---|---|
Syntax | Scala has a syntax that is similar to Java and supports both object-oriented and functional programming paradigms. | CoffeeScript has a more concise and expressive syntax compared to JavaScript. |
Paradigm | Scala supports both object-oriented and functional programming paradigms. | CoffeeScript is primarily a functional programming language. |
Typing | Scala is a statically typed language. | CoffeeScript is a dynamically typed language. |
Performance | Scala is known for its high performance and scalability. | CoffeeScript's performance is dependent on the underlying JavaScript engine. |
Libraries and frameworks | Scala has a rich ecosystem of libraries and frameworks, including popular ones like Akka and Play. | CoffeeScript leverages the existing JavaScript libraries and frameworks. |
Community and support | Scala has a strong and active community with good support. | CoffeeScript has a smaller community compared to other languages. |
Learning curve | Scala has a steep learning curve due to its complex features and concepts. | CoffeeScript has a relatively low learning curve, especially for developers familiar with JavaScript. |
